Class UnknownTriggerService
- java.lang.Object
 - 
- jetbrains.buildServer.buildTriggers.BuildTriggerService
 - 
- jetbrains.buildServer.serverSide.impl.UnknownTriggerService
 
 
 
- 
- All Implemented Interfaces:
 ServerExtension,TeamCityExtension
public class UnknownTriggerService extends BuildTriggerService
- Author:
 - Pavel.Sher
 
 
- 
- 
Constructor Summary
Constructors Constructor Description UnknownTriggerService(String triggerName) 
- 
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description StringdescribeTrigger(BuildTriggerDescriptor trigger)Returns human readable description of the provided build trigger settingsBuildTriggeringPolicygetBuildTriggeringPolicy()Returns policy used by build trigger to trigger builds.StringgetDisplayName()Returns name of this trigger to show in UI.StringgetEditParametersUrl()Returns path to jsp or to custom controller which will return trigger edit parameters page To resolve paths in plugin, seePluginDescriptor.getPluginResourcesPath(String)StringgetName()Returns trigger namebooleanisMultipleTriggersPerBuildTypeAllowed()Returns true if more than one trigger of this type can be added to the build configuration or template.- 
Methods inherited from class jetbrains.buildServer.buildTriggers.BuildTriggerService
getDefaultTriggerProperties, getTriggerPropertiesProcessor, isAvailable, supportsBuildCustomization 
 - 
 
 - 
 
- 
- 
Constructor Detail
- 
UnknownTriggerService
public UnknownTriggerService(@NotNull String triggerName) 
 - 
 
- 
Method Detail
- 
getName
@NotNull public String getName()
Description copied from class:BuildTriggerServiceReturns trigger name- Specified by:
 getNamein classBuildTriggerService- Returns:
 - trigger name
 
 
- 
getDisplayName
@NotNull public String getDisplayName()
Description copied from class:BuildTriggerServiceReturns name of this trigger to show in UI.- Specified by:
 getDisplayNamein classBuildTriggerService- Returns:
 - see above
 
 
- 
describeTrigger
@NotNull public String describeTrigger(@NotNull BuildTriggerDescriptor trigger)
Description copied from class:BuildTriggerServiceReturns human readable description of the provided build trigger settings- Specified by:
 describeTriggerin classBuildTriggerService- Parameters:
 trigger- trigger- Returns:
 - see above
 
 
- 
getEditParametersUrl
public String getEditParametersUrl()
Description copied from class:BuildTriggerServiceReturns path to jsp or to custom controller which will return trigger edit parameters page To resolve paths in plugin, seePluginDescriptor.getPluginResourcesPath(String)- Overrides:
 getEditParametersUrlin classBuildTriggerService- Returns:
 - see above
 - See Also:
 PluginDescriptor
 
- 
getBuildTriggeringPolicy
@NotNull public BuildTriggeringPolicy getBuildTriggeringPolicy()
Description copied from class:BuildTriggerServiceReturns policy used by build trigger to trigger builds.- Specified by:
 getBuildTriggeringPolicyin classBuildTriggerService- Returns:
 - build triggering policy
 
 
- 
isMultipleTriggersPerBuildTypeAllowed
public boolean isMultipleTriggersPerBuildTypeAllowed()
Description copied from class:BuildTriggerServiceReturns true if more than one trigger of this type can be added to the build configuration or template. By default returns false.- Overrides:
 isMultipleTriggersPerBuildTypeAllowedin classBuildTriggerService- Returns:
 - see above
 
 
 - 
 
 -